Summary

Senate Resolution 723 acknowledges March 3, 2026, as Blue and White Day at the state capitol, recognizing the contributions of the Phi Beta Sigma Fraternity, Incorporated, and the Zeta Phi Beta Sorority, Incorporated. These organizations are noted for their extensive service and community impact throughout Georgia, highlighting their commitment to civic engagement and empowering communities across the state. The bill celebrates their legacy and dedicated efforts towards addressing social and health inequities within marginalized populations.
